About The Position

This is a part-time role for an Occupational Therapist (OT) focused on providing direct therapy to students. The position is designed to offer 20 hours of work per week, emphasizing clinical work with autistic students in the Lilac Learning Center program. The role aims to provide an alternative to traditional OT positions that may involve excessive paperwork and productivity quotas, allowing therapists to focus on actual therapy. The company values this part-time role as a substantial job, not a secondary one. The work involves evaluations, treatment, and direct OT services. The company acknowledges that serving autistic students can be challenging work. The position is remote for therapists located in Washington or holding a Washington license. For strong OTs outside Washington, the company will cover licensing fees and assist with the application process.
